Paper and Book production in the Muslim world
"The composing of books is
more effective than building in recording the accomplishments of the
passing ages and centuries. For there is no doubt that construction
eventually perishes, and its traces disappear, while books handed from
one generation to another, and from nation to nation, remain ever
renewed. ... Were it not for the wisdom garnered in books most of the
learning would have been lost. The power of forgetfulness would have
triumphed over the power of memory." Jahiz (d.255/869) "Praise of
Books"
